Postpartum Recovery: A Week-by-Week Guide
Postpartum recovery is the healing and adjustment period after childbirth, typically the first 6 weeks. Expect vaginal bleeding, cramping, perineal soreness, breast changes, fatigue, and emotional shifts. Most physical healing occurs by 6 weeks, but full recovery can take months. Rest, accept help, and watch for red flags like heavy bleeding, fever, or thoughts of harming yourself or your baby.
